A BIO-CNG plant is a complex system of interconnected processes. Raw biogas is first produced in anaerobic digesters, then purified and upgraded to remove carbon dioxide, hydrogen sulfide, and other impurities, and finally compressed to create BIO-CNG. Each stage of this process has a specific operational requirement. The digesters produce biogas at a variable rate, while the upgrading and compression units demand a continuous, stable feed of gas to operate efficiently.
This is where Stand-Alone Gasholders become a critical link. Positioned as a dedicated storage vessel, separate from the digesters, these units serve as a crucial buffer. Their primary functions include:
Buffering Variable Production: The gasholder collects biogas during peak production periods and stores it, releasing it at a controlled rate to the downstream upgrading equipment. This ensures that the plant's most expensive components—the upgrading and compression units—can run continuously and at an optimal flow rate, maximizing their throughput and efficiency.
Pressure Regulation: They maintain a stable, low-pressure environment for the biogas, which is essential for the smooth operation of the upgrading system. This regulated pressure prevents pressure spikes or drops that could disrupt the purification process, ensuring the final BIO-CNG product meets strict quality specifications.
Large-Scale Storage: Because they are stand-alone units, they are not constrained by the size of the digester tanks. This allows for the construction of very large-volume gasholders, providing a substantial storage buffer. This is particularly important for large BIO-CNG plants that need to store significant volumes of biogas to balance supply with demand, especially during periods of high energy demand.
By providing this crucial storage buffer, Stand-Alone Gasholders enable a BIO-CNG plant to run smoothly, reducing operational costs and maximizing profitability.
At Center Enamel, our Stand-Alone Gasholders are engineered with a sophisticated, dual-membrane design that provides a superior solution for low-pressure gas management. This innovative design offers a dedicated, large-volume storage unit without the safety and maintenance concerns of rigid, high-pressure tanks. The gasholder is constructed from robust, gas-tight membrane material—a specialized PVC-coated polyester fabric—chosen for its exceptional durability and resistance to the corrosive gases and UV exposure found in biogas environments.
The key components of this dual-layer system are:
Inner Membrane: This flexible membrane forms the primary gas containment chamber. It expands and contracts dynamically as gas volume changes, storing the biogas and preventing dangerous pressure buildups or vacuums.
Outer Membrane: This permanently inflated, dome-shaped external layer provides structural stability and protection. Maintained under a slight positive air pressure, it shields the inner membrane and the stored biogas from extreme weather conditions. The insulated air gap between the two membranes helps to maintain a stable gas temperature, which is vital for the optimal performance of the entire system.
Bottom Membrane: Unlike tank-mounted gasholders, the stand-alone design features a third membrane that forms the base of the gasholder, providing a completely sealed and gas-tight storage unit that can be installed on a simple concrete slab.
This unique, multi-membrane system guarantees absolute gas-tightness, effectively capturing all valuable biogas and mitigating fugitive methane emissions.

Inner Mongolia Bio-Natural Gas Project, China:
Application: Our stand-alone gasholders were an integral part of this large-scale bio-natural gas plant. They served as the primary storage and collection point for biogas produced from animal waste. This low-pressure buffer was essential for ensuring a stable and continuous feedstock for the plant’s upgrading and compression systems, which processed the gas into high-purity natural gas.
Project Case: This bio-natural gas project in Inner Mongolia utilized 4 units of our stand-alone gasholders, providing a total storage volume of 16,760m³. This extensive capacity was vital for managing the variable biogas production and optimizing the plant’s conversion of biogas into sellable biomethane.
